The village of Virelles in the valley of the Eau Blanche has a history that is closely linked to the river. Up to Vaulx, you follow charming paths that take you deeper into the Blaimont forest. Due to the schistous nature of the soil, the Virelles forest mainly consists of deciduous trees such as oaks and beeches. "Le Trou des Sarrazins" is a gorge that was formed millions of years ago and was already present in the Neolithic period. During that time, the water deposited rock with iron ore there. The mineral was called “le Sarrazin” by the inhabitants of Virelles and supplied the village’s forges. Iron ore extraction was halted in the 18th century.
